278 def get_nat44_sessions_number(node, proto):
279 """Get number of expected NAT44 sessions from NAT44 mapping data.
281 This keyword uses output from a CLI command,
282 so it can start failing when VPP changes the output format.
283 TODO: Switch to API (or stat segment) when available.
285 The current implementation supports both 2202 and post-2202 format.
286 (The Gerrit number changing the output format is 34877.)
288 For TCP proto, the expected state after rampup is
289 some number of sessions in transitory state (VPP has seen the FINs),
290 and some number of sessions in established state (meaning
291 some FINs were lost in the last trial).
292 While the two states may need slightly different number of cycles
293 to process next packet, the current implementation considers
294 both of them the "fast path", so they are both counted as expected.
296 As the tests should fail if a session is timed-out,
297 the logic substracts timed out sessions for the returned value
298 (only available for post-2202 format).
300 TODO: Investigate if it is worth to insert additional rampup trials
301 in TPUT tests to ensure all sessions are transitory before next
